Overlay waterproofing to two flat roof areas of an occupied residential block, using the Bauder Total Roof System. Works in progress.
The existing felt waterproofing on the two flat roof areas had reached the end of its serviceable life. Rather than a full strip and structural rebuild, the roofs were assessed as suitable for a Bauder overlay — the new system installed over the prepared existing deck, following surface preparation and localised remedial works.
Doing this while scaffold and access were already in place kept disruption to residents and cost to the client both down.
Bauder K5K capping sheet — elastomeric bitumen with a 250g/m² spunbond polyester reinforcement.
BauderTEC KSA DUO — self-adhesive elastomeric bituminous membrane with glass lattice reinforcement and DUO lap technology.
The system allows flame-free detailing for application near combustible construction materials — a key safety consideration on occupied residential roofs.
Installed as a two-layer, self-adhered system to both the Main Roof and Roof 2, backed by the Bauder system guarantee.
